New scam technique targets Piedmont man, who lost thousands

Updated: 4:57 PM EDT May 17, 2021 Watch the full story tonight on WFMY News 2 at 11. Michael Marrs has lived in Mocksville for about as long as he can remember. Like most people, he trusts someone when they tell him something. So, when he got a phone call one day, he heard something alarming on the other end. The caller claimed they were with the Social Security Administration. He said Marrs’ social security number was tied to a drug ring in Texas, there was a warrant for his arrest and he needed to pay up. Attorney General Josh Stein Fights to Protect Students from Bullying

For Immediate Release: Friday, February 26, 2021 Contact: Laura Brewer (919) 716-6484 (RALEIGH) Attorney General Josh Stein filed a friend-of-the-court brief urging the U.S. Supreme Court to preserve schools’ ability to address cyberbullying and other forms of off-campus bullying that substantially affect students’ education. “When bullies target students, they no longer just do it at school during the day,” said Attorney General Josh Stein. “Our young people can be bullied anywhere, at any time.
